Rates & Terms

Borrowers in Newcastle who consolidate $15,000 in credit card debt at 20% APR into a 5-year loan at 11% APR save over $4,000 in interest.

Debt consolidation loan rates in Newcastle range from 6.99% to 35.99% APR, with the best rates reserved for borrowers with scores above 720.

Requirements in Newcastle

Most debt consolidation lenders in Newcastle require a minimum credit score of 580-640 and a debt-to-income ratio below 50%.

A stable employment history of 12+ months improves approval odds for debt consolidation loans in Newcastle.

Borrowing Tips for Newcastle

  • Avoid consolidation if the new rate is not significantly lower than your current weighted average rate.
  • Set up automatic payments to avoid late fees and potential rate increases on your consolidation loan.
  • Consider nonprofit credit counseling in Newcastle before taking a high-rate consolidation loan.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I get a debt consolidation loan with bad credit in Newcastle?

Yes, but rates will be higher. Consider adding a co-signer, securing the loan with collateral, or working with a credit counselor to improve your credit before applying.

What is the difference between debt consolidation and debt settlement in Newcastle?

Debt consolidation pays your debts in full with a new loan. Debt settlement negotiates to pay less than owed, severely damaging your credit and potentially creating tax liability on forgiven amounts.

How long does it take to pay off a consolidation loan?

Terms typically range from 2 to 7 years. Choose the shortest term with affordable payments to minimize interest and become debt-free faster.

Will a debt consolidation loan hurt my credit score?

Initially, the hard inquiry may lower your score slightly. Over time, consolidation can improve your score by reducing credit utilization and establishing a positive payment history.
